Transaction 229606548975d1bcbb134ca6661b285643e4534ae4fa275b3241bb84eca36eef

1 Input
2 Outputs
  • 229606548975d1bcbb134ca6661b285643e4534ae4fa275b3241bb84eca36eef:0
  • value  50000000
    address  353UfcbAiLaWbJo9Cb3WVmUbVZD1GFYoX4
  • 229606548975d1bcbb134ca6661b285643e4534ae4fa275b3241bb84eca36eef:1
  • value  88776240
    address  18Cdkg38nzte6ChFauEzwyK76cEjHJu36g